Choice Silver Didrachm from Caria - Pixodaros

Asia Minor, Caria, Satraps of Pixodaros, 340 BCE to 334 BCE. OBVERSE: Laureated head of Apollo facing slightly right. REVERSE: Zeus Labraundos to right with double axe. Greek inscription to right. This important and beautiful coin features a beautifully stylized portrait of Apollo, the Roman god often associated with medicine and healing. The reverse side has a standing Zeus Labraundos depicted holding a double axe. This happens to be an excellent example of some of the finest of Classical Greek die mastery. Compare SNG von Aulock 2375–2376; SNG Kayhan 891–892. Size: 7.10 grams, 19 mm.
